The Pradox simulation game takes a little longer to develop. The Early Access date of
Life By You is pushed back to June 4, 2024 to refine the visuals and gameplay. A slight postponement which pushes the studio to explain its decision, and address reimbursement for players who no longer believe in the project. The good news in all of this, the developers seem to be listening to the community.

As a reminder, Life By You is a life simulation halfway between The Sims And Second Life. It is therefore a question of players being able to embody an avatar, take care of their house, find a job, interact with other people… By postponing the release for a few months, the studio hopes to review its copy to meet the expectations of players. They are therefore based on the feedback of those who were able to access it for this purpose.

With this postponement until June 4, 2024, Paradox hopes that Life By You can achieve its objectives. Whether in terms of freedom or constraints, everything must be as smooth as possible. To hope to compete with the pillar of this genre, The Sims, the studio has no room for error. Their only advantage is the promise of offering more in the base game, without having to buy dozens of DLCs. We must therefore hope that this promise is still valid.
